Check Your Boobs!
I had a difficult time after surgery as many know...however, I recently turned the poverbial VSG corner in the last few weeks...I can eat some foods now... get my Protein & fluids down without the constant nausea & pains...thank goodness/valuim,bentyil & zantac! So I'm back to work fulltime, taking care of grandson even went on a Anniversary date with my husband to our favorite Chinese restaurant (PF Changs) had egg drop Soup & 2 shrimp steamed dumplings WITHOUT throwing up immediately in the restroom!!! All this and I am wearing 10/12 super Cute jeans!! (OMG reallY???) It seemed like I could finally breath deep and get things done that I had put off...during the rather Orrible months since VSG. So firstly, I had my regular mammogram that I had put off (6 months) last week...they called me back next day on friday and said can u come back today for a rescan...I knew with my mom dying of breast cancer that it might not be good..long story short they said I have what looks like stage 1 breast cancer. I go back tomorrow for a lumpectomy and will find out within 24 hours if they are right. I say all this to remind you ladies DO NOT put of something so damn important...get those boobs checked regularly and ON TIME...please!! Strangely I am pretty calm...(not hubby! bless) I figure if it is...then I will fight it, in the mean time I am reading everything I can about what's in store and trying to stay positive. Hugs to you all! PLEASE #CHECK YOUR BOOBS!!!! Nancy x

How Long Until You Ate Salad, Steak, Bread?
I'm 3.5 months out & I have salad a few times a week no issues, little bites of bread in SMALL toasted bites like croutons go down okay. Steak is so heavy on my stomach I have tried it a few times & it still hurts once it goes down. Strangely most meats are not staying down well... chicken seems heavy too no matter how I cook it. Fish, seafood are my main source of proteins at the moment. I loved red meats before but now my stomach says NO Maybe someday. Hope all of you are having a great day! x

How's This For 'fried' Food?
Hello Mary, I had a similar issue for nearly 10 weeks out when a test showed I had H pylori with a peptic ulcer...2 weeks of antibiotics and I am finally able to eat small portions without all the nausea! Keep asking your Dr. at first I was put off with "this is normal for some folks to have nausea etc" until I started throwing up blood then tests showed what was really wrong. Keep the faith it will get better! x
